Implements Operational Transformation (OT) for Racket.
Inspired by the simplicity and elegance of the presentation in this blog post.
Run
raco pkg install operational-transformation
Or, if you only want the library and not the demos,
raco pkg install operational-transformation-lib

Find a text file you wish to collaboratively edit. Let's call it
foo.txt
.
Make sure you don't mind if foo.txt
is saved to disk! Each time a
change is made by a connected client, the demo server saves over the
file.
Change to the directory containing foo.txt
and run
racket -l operational-transformation-demo/server foo.txt
This will start a TCP server on localhost, port 5888 by default.
Supply -p <portnumber>
before foo.txt
on the command-line to
select a different port.
Then, run multiple clients. Start each client with
racket -l operational-transformation-demo/client localhost
Again, supply -p <portnumber>
before localhost
to select a
different server port.
